Taylor of Brooklyn's skincare products, particularly the facial oils, are highly appreciated by users. The oils leave the skin feeling hydrated, moisturized, and glowing. The products are known for their fast absorption and non-greasy feel. The packaging is cute and the brand is praised for its gender-neutral vibe. The company also seems to offer a good customer experience, often including personalized handwritten notes in the packages. On the downside, some users found the product to have an unusual smell, which could be off-putting for some. The yellow-orange tint of the oil was also a concern, especially for users with fair complexions. The products were also considered a bit pricey, and some users wished for a dropper instead of a pump for dispensing the oil.
